  • From Custom Builds to Fivetran: Evolving Our Data Pipeline Strategy
    Aug 14 2025

    In this episode of The Dashboard Effect, Brick and Landon discuss their shift in thinking on whether to build custom data connectors or use third-party tools like Fivetran. They share the pros, cons, and lessons learned from their proof-of-concept with Fivetran, and why APIs are changing the data pipeline game.

    Key Moments:

    1:15 – Why custom connectors made sense in the past
    2:00 – The rise of APIs and the challenge of building connectors for them
    2:39 – Realizing the variety of systems—and limits of pre-built connectors
    4:03 – How Fivetran’s dedicated API teams save time and reduce risk
    4:57 – Turnaround times and when a custom build is still needed
    5:56 – Cost trade-offs: upfront development vs. subscription model
    6:30 – Support considerations for in-house vs. third-party connectors
    6:41 – Exploring other tools and continuing custom pipeline work
    7:11 – Closing thoughts and advice for data teams
